Dr. David Kim, MD is a Pain Medicine Specialist in Warrenton, VA and has over 25 years of experience in the medical field. He graduated from UMDNJ-- New Jersey Medical School in 1998. He is affiliated with Fauquier Hospital. His office accepts new patients and telehealth appointments.

I used to be on high dose narcotics along with xanax, ambien and soma from my previous pain doctor. I never felt quite well and Dr. Kim took time to explain why I should not be on narcotics and xanax and soma together as the combination can kill by affecting my heart rhythm and also cause sleep apnea and difficulty sleeping. He also explain that the medications I was on caused me to gain weight and make me sicker than my spouse for same cold. NO other doctor ever explained this to me before!!
